Movie Review: The Host

IMDB, The Host“The Host” on IMDB

Horror, 120 Minutes, 2006

I’m not sure where this movie has been hiding for 10 years, but it should have come out and waved a long time ago! Classically themed monster movies are something of a rarity; especially in the United States. Luckily, as is often the case, the foreign market – in this case South Korea – is often ready to step in and pick the slack when Hollywood decides that moony-eyed-teen-love-triangles is the only thing that will sell.

Movie Review: Return of the Killer Shrews

IMDB, Return of the Killer Shrews“Return of the Killer Shrews” on IMDB

Horror, 84 Minutes, 2012

There’s a long, ignoble tradition of terrible movies taking advantage of good – or at least popular – movies. A movie really can’t be considered a success unless a loosely veiled B-version (and at least one even less loosely veiled porn parody) are available within two months of release. This may be the first one to try take advantage of a mostly forgotten horrible movie.
